Capita Scaling Partner contender: Infoshare

TIPP logoInfoshare was one of just six UK tech scaleups shortlisted for the recent Capita Scaling Partner pitch event held in association with the TechMarketView Innovation Partner Programme. Contenders are vying for the opportunity for a transformative partnership with UK business systems leader, Capita.

Infoshare logoTMV had the pleasure to meet Pamela Cook and Richard Onslow - respectively CEO and Business Development Director of Infoshare - at the recent Capita Scaling Partner Programme pitch event in London.

Infoshare is a B2B data-for-good company, specialising in creating accurate, enriched and up-to-date single views of data. It uses leading data quality and data management software to transform customer data into a strategic asset by cleansing and linking records from across disparate siloed business systems and by enabling information sharing between organisations.

The company's target market is those organisations holding critical data on individuals, particularly where that data may be inaccurate or incomplete, or organisations needing effective processes for managing personal data and consent. But their traditional markets are expanding; the growing adoption of machine learning, automation and analytics solutions to generate value from data requires the underlying data feeding into these solutions to be accurate and reliable.

Infoshare's technologies were built in collaboration with social care and police analysts to match mission-critical and highly sensitive data that require the highest levels of accuracy and transparency. This incorporates powerful evidence-based, iterative matching and customer consent reconciliation to resolve customers' conflicting data held in multiple databases, enabling organisations to trust their data and have the confidence to use it strategically.

As the volume of data generated and stored in public and private organisations grows, so too does the need to organise and share that data in a way which facilitates decision-making. Infoshare has proven their ability to automatically process tens of millions of records daily, saving their customers significant time or cost. They are already responsible for processing the data for an impressive client roster across both the private and public sectors, including Royal Mail, Pets at Home and the Met Police.

The growing market for Infoshare should therefore be sizeable and we watch their progress with interest.
